Radio Bookclub

The February selection for the Radio Bookclub is Bratwurst Haven, a collection of linked short stories by Rachel King. The twelve stories are set in a small town in Boulder County, where a sausage factory binds the diverse characters together. King tells their stories of their internal and external struggles.

The Radio Bookclub is a collaboration between KGNU and the Boulder Bookstore and is broadcast on the 4th Thursday of every month at 9am. The entire series, including Afterhours at the Radio Bookclub, is available as a podcast.
